如何解决如何在网络应用程序中集成谷歌文档预览、编辑、保存 答案:更多信息:注意事项:相关问题:参考:
我想在网络应用程序 (Angular 10) 中集成 google 文档,以便预览、编辑和保存。
我的服务器上存储了文档。我想使用存储在我的服务器上的谷歌文档预览文档(它可以存储在 Amazon S3 或 Azure 等上)。
我想使用谷歌文档编辑该文档并将其保存回我的服务器(用户使用谷歌凭据登录并获得所有权限)。
我知道这一点: https://docs.google.com/a/[DOMINIO]/viewer?url=[FILE_URL] ,但它是 用于预览,文件大小限制为 25 MB。
基本上,我需要集成 google docs,以便在我的网络应用程序中预览、编辑和保存文档。
我想通过 Microsoft Office 365(订阅)实现的相同功能。
如何实现?
解决方法
答案:
唯一的 方法是使用第三方存储系统。
更多信息:
根据 Edit Drive files on 3rd-party storage systems 上的帮助文章:
作为管理员,您可以让您单位中的用户编辑存储在第三方存储系统上的 Google 文档、表格和幻灯片(Google 文件)。
和:
为了支持编辑和协作,Google 会将存储在第三方服务器上的文件缓存 30 天。在缓存文件时,其内容受 Google 条款的约束。存储在第三方服务器上的 Google 文件受第三方条款的约束。
此外,只能通过第三方提供商的控件来管理、控制、删除和导出存储在第三方服务器上的 Google 文件。存储在第三方服务器上的 Google 文件无法使用 Google 云端硬盘文件管理控制措施,包括访问控制、数据位置承诺、数据丢失防护 (DLP)、保管库保留政策和云端硬盘 API 访问权限。
注意事项:
- 如果您的组织在存储提供商处拥有付费帐户,则每个用户都必须使用 Google Workspace 帐户登录。
- 与用户的存储提供商帐户和 Google Workspace 帐户关联的电子邮件地址必须匹配。为确保地址匹配,请将与您用户的存储提供商帐户关联的电子邮件地址添加为其 Google Workspace 帐户的电子邮件别名。
您可以在上面的链接中阅读更多相关信息。
相关问题:
参考:
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。